Q: Is 1,574,595 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,574,595 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,574,595 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1574595 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 9 11 15 33 45 55 99 165 495 3,181 9,543 15,905 28,629 34,991 47,715 104,973 143,145 174,955 314,919 524,865 and 1,574,595, with no remainder.

Since 1,574,595 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,574,595, it is not a prime number.
